Prior to you begin functioning on your home with a stress or power washer, you need to obtain acquainted with the various types of spray nozzles. The angle/degree of the spray is typically exactly how they're identified and relates to the "fan" of water spray that they give off.


This 25 spray head is a really flexible option due to the fact that it combines the pressure of a tight-spraying follower of water with a fast-rotating cone. Pulsating anywhere from 1,800 to 3,000 RPMs, this nozzle's terrific for deep cleaning difficult surface areas. When you're fortifying your tidy water with detergent, this is the nozzle to make use of.


Essentially a water laser, this is one powerful jet and needs to be used with extreme care. Made use of to draw caked-on dirt off of building devices and strip away corrosion on tools, this nozzle won't likely see a whole lot of usage around the home. Is pressure cleaning negative for your house? It can be if you're making use of the incorrect nozzle.

Even if you do not own a power washing machine or you're not up to getting the work done yourself, you have choices.


And the prices for power cleaning are normally billed on a per-square-foot basis, ranging from $0.30 - $0.80 per square foot to cleanse your home. These systems are normally gas powered and use extremely warm water or vapor. Here's a list of some power washing services and the average expenses for every: Spray out seamless gutters: $50 - $150 Get rid of mold and mildew and mildew from vinyl-sided homes: $170 - $360 Tidy up pavers or concrete: $100 - $270 Eliminate moss from roof covering: $250 - $600 Tidy up decks and patio areas: $120 - $250 Wash down fencing: $150 - $300 If they're connecting to your water via a garden tube, you can expect them to spray out regarding 10 - 15 gallons of water per min.
